PAYX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2023 in Review

1,429 of the 6,275 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Paychex (PAYX) for Q1 2023, worth a combined $30.2B — up 0.9% from $29.9B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 111 funds opened new PAYX positions and 102 closed out — a net gain of 9 holders — while 503 added to existing stakes and 567 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Bank of America, adding an estimated $288M. The largest seller was Arrowstreet Capital, cutting an estimated $88.5M.
